Aastrom Biosciences to Present At BMO Capital Markets Healthcare Conference

ANN ARBOR, Mich., Aug. 3, 2009 (GLOBE NEWSWIRE) — Aastrom Biosciences, Inc. (Nasdaq:ASTM), a leading developer of autologous adult stem cell treatments for severe chronic cardiovascular diseases, today announced that George Dunbar, President and Chief Executive Officer, and Elmar Burchardt, MD, PhD, Vice President, Medical Affairs, will present at the BMO Capital Markets 9th Annual Focus on Healthcare Conference. The conference will be held on Wednesday, August 5th at the Millennium Broadway Hotel in New York City. Aastrom will present at 8:00 a.m. (Eastern Time).

About Aastrom Biosciences, Inc.
Aastrom is a leader in the development of autologous cell products for the repair or regeneration of human tissue. The Company’s proprietary Tissue Repair Cell (TRC) technology involves the use of a patient’s own cells to manufacture products to treat a range of chronic diseases and serious injuries. Aastrom’s TRC-based products contain increased numbers of stem and early progenitor cells, produced from a small amount of bone marrow collected from the patient. The TRC technology platform has positioned Aastrom to advance multiple products into clinical development. TRC-based products have been used in over 325 patients with over 10 years of positive safety data. The Company’s ongoing development activities focus on applying TRC technology to cardiac and vascular tissue regeneration. The Company is currently focused on cardiovascular regeneration through a Phase II clinical trial with dilated cardiomyopathy (DCM) patients (the IMPACT-DCM trial) and a Phase IIb clinical trial with critical limb ischemia (CLI) patients (the RESTORE-CLI trial).
